How We Handle a Complaint
Once a complaint is received, it is reviewed by the appropriate member of our team. We begin by acknowledging the concern and checking the information provided. The goal is not to argue the point, but to understand what happened and determine the most suitable next step. In many cases, a simple clarification is enough to resolve the matter.
If additional inspection is needed, we may assess the cleaned area or review the service details to understand the situation more fully. This stage is important because carpet cleaning outcomes can be affected by many factors, including fabric type, prior staining, or pre-existing wear. Our Longlands carpet cleaning complaint process always takes these conditions into account.
Where a mistake has occurred, we aim to act quickly and fairly. Depending on the nature of the complaint, possible remedies may include a return visit, a re-clean of specific areas, or another appropriate solution. We focus on practical outcomes rather than lengthy delays, because we know customers value a prompt response.

Raising a Complaint
To help us review a concern efficiently, it is useful to include relevant service details and a short description of the issue. If there are specific areas of the carpet that are affected, identifying them clearly can help us assess the situation more accurately. This approach supports a quicker and more focused review of your Longlands carpet cleaners complaint.
When submitting a complaint, keeping the explanation concise but complete is usually best. Mentioning what happened, when it happened, and what outcome you are seeking helps us understand your expectations. A clear statement also reduces the need for unnecessary follow-up questions.
We encourage customers to raise concerns as soon as possible after noticing an issue. Prompt reporting often makes it easier to review the service while the details are still fresh. This supports a more effective and efficient resolution process.
